Dakar

Located in West Africa, Dakar is the capital city of Senegal and an Atlantic port on the Cap-Vert peninsula. Main attractions include the city's markets, the Dakar Grand Mosque, Goree Island, the IFAN Museum, the African Renaissance Monument, beaches, and the Senegal Zoo.

Nassau

There are few vacation destinations more famous than the Bahamian city of Nassau. This capital city is full of laid back locals, relaxed tourists and the iconic pastel pink government houses.

As the largest city in the Bahamas, Nassau can hold plenty of people. Not only are there hundreds of tourists on any given day, the city is also home to 260,000 people – that is 80 percent of the Bahamas' total population.

Founded around 1650, Nassau's location made it a great spot on the trade route. So great, in fact, that it also became a popular destination for pirates – including the infamous Blackbeard.

Pack light because it's going to be pretty steamy in Nassau. The climate is essentially identical to southern Florida. It is warm and humid all year with the occasional cold snap in the winter.

Which place is cheaper, Nassau or Dakar?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Dakar is $61, while the average daily cost in Nassau is $189.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Dakar and Nassau in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Dakar or Nassau?

Both destinations experience a warmer climate with nice weather most of the year. Instead of summer and winter seasons, they usually have a rainy season and a dry season.

Should I visit Dakar or Nassau in the Summer?

The summer attracts plenty of travelers to both Dakar and Nassau. Warm weather and sunshine bring visitors to Dakar year-round. Nassau attracts visitors year-round for its warm weather and sunny climate.

Nassau receives a lot of rain in the summer. In July, Dakar usually receives less rain than Nassau. Dakar gets 50 mm (2 in) of rain, while Nassau receives 151 mm (5.9 in) of rain each month for the summer.

People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Nassau this time of the year. In Dakar, it's very sunny this time of the year. Dakar usually receives less sunshine than Nassau during summer. Dakar gets 218 hours of sunny skies, while Nassau receives 273 hours of full sun in the summer.

Dakar is around the same temperature as Nassau in the summer. The daily temperature in Dakar averages around 28°C (82°F) in July, and Nassau fluctuates around 28°C (82°F).

Typical Weather for Nassau and Dakar

Dakar Nassau
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 22°C (72°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 21°C (70°F) 51 mm (2 in)
Feb 21°C (70°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 21°C (70°F) 45 mm (1.8 in)
Mar 22°C (72°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 22°C (72°F) 43 mm (1.7 in)
Apr 21°C (70°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 23°C (74°F) 53 mm (2.1 in)
May 23°C (73°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 25°C (77°F) 116 mm (4.6 in)
Jun 26°C (79°F) 20 mm (0.8 in) 27°C (80°F) 237 mm (9.3 in)
Jul 28°C (82°F) 50 mm (2 in) 28°C (82°F) 151 mm (5.9 in)
Aug 28°C (82°F) 150 mm (5.9 in) 28°C (82°F) 211 mm (8.3 in)
Sep 28°C (82°F) 150 mm (5.9 in) 27°C (81°F) 171 mm (6.7 in)
Oct 28°C (82°F) 20 mm (0.8 in) 26°C (79°F) 184 mm (7.2 in)
Nov 26°C (79°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 24°C (75°F) 55 mm (2.2 in)
Dec 24°C (75°F) 10 mm (0.4 in) 22°C (71°F) 60 mm (2.4 in)
